Language ZAR/ZA

Book Cheap flights to Duck, North Carolina (DUF) in 2024/2025 from South Africa

Return

1

Adults

- +

Children

Aged 2-12

- +

Infant

Aged 0-2

- +

Reset

Confirm

Economy

  • We compare
  • Kayak
  • Skyscanner
  • Momondo
  • Cheapflights
  • Jetradar
  • Kiwi
Departing
Departing
Returning

Flight 1

Departing

Flight 2

Departing

Flight 3

Departing

Flight 4

Departing

Flight 5

Departing

Flight 6

Departing

Add another flight

Clear all

Flexible Dates

How to find flight deals to Duck, North Carolina:

How to find flight deals to Duck, North Carolina:

1. Enter your search requirements for Duck, North Carolina

2. Compare the best Duck, North Carolina deals from top comparison engines
2. Compare the best Duck, North Carolina deals from top comparison engines
2. Compare the best Duck, North Carolina deals from top comparison engines
2. Compare the best Duck, North Carolina deals from top comparison engines

2. Compare the best Duck, North Carolina deals from top comparison engines

How to find flight deals to Duck, North Carolina:

3. Book your Duck, North Carolina flight at the cheapest price

Recent deals found from

to:
in:

Map of Duck, North Carolina

How to find cheap and flexible flights to Duck, North Carolina - Q & A

Located on the Outer Banks of North Carolina, Duck is a charming seaside town known for its pristine beaches, quaint shops, and stunning sunsets. This coastal gem offers a peaceful retreat for visitors looking to unwind and take in the natural beauty of the Atlantic coastline. With its laid-back atmosphere and friendly community, Duck provides the perfect setting for relaxing beach vacations and outdoor adventures. Whether you're strolling along the boardwalk, kayaking in the sound, or simply enjoying fresh seafood at a local restaurant, Duck promises a delightful escape for all who visit.

Which month is cheapest to fly to Duck, North Carolina?

The cheapest month to fly to Duck, North Carolina is typically January.

Which popular airports are close to Duck, North Carolina?

Popular airports near Duck, North Carolina include Norfolk International Airport (ORF) in Norfolk, Virginia; Newport News/Williamsburg International Airport (PHF) in Newport News, Virginia; and Raleigh-Durham International Airport (RDU) in Raleigh, North Carolina.

How long does it take to fly to Duck, North Carolina?

The flight to Duck, North Carolina (DUF) is roughly 18 hours 17 minutes and 8,005 miles (12,882 kilometres) from Johannesburg, South Africa - O.R. Tambo Internationall Airport (JNB).

How do I find the cheapest possible flights to Duck, North Carolina?

The best way is to compare flights to Duck, North Carolina from leading comparison sites using our search engine dashboard.

Things to do in Duck, North Carolina

Duck Town Park Boardwalk

Mile long boardwalk on banks of a sound

Town of Duck

City government office

Ghost Crab Quest, LLC

Tourist attraction

Currituck County Rural Center

Golf, canal, fishing, and camping

Weather in Duck, North Carolina

Clouds
Clouds

16 °C

Sun, 28 Apr 2024

Flight Distance and Flying Time to Duck, North Carolina

Flights from Johannesburg, South Africa - O.R. Tambo Internationall Airport (JNB)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,005 miles (12,882 kilometres). The direct flight time is roughly 18 hours 17 minutes.

Flights from Cape Town, South Africa - Cape Town International Airport (CPT)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,768 miles (12,502 kilometres). The direct flight time is roughly 17 hours 45 minutes.

Flights from Durban, South Africa - King Shaka Intl Airport (DUR)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,273 miles (13,315 kilometres). The direct flight time is roughly 18 hours 53 minutes.

Flights from George, South Africa - George Airport (GRJ)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,959 miles (12,809 kilometres). The direct flight time is roughly 18 hours 11 minutes.

Flights from Lanseria, South Africa - Lanseria International Airport (HLA)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,980 miles (12,843 kilometres). The direct flight time is roughly 18 hours 14 minutes.

Flights from Port Elizabeth, South Africa - Port Elizabeth Airport (PLZ)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,123 miles (13,073 kilometres). The direct flight time is roughly 18 hours 33 minutes.

Flights from Bloemfontein, South Africa - Bloemfontein International Airport (BFN)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,000 miles (12,875 kilometres). The direct flight time is roughly 18 hours 16 minutes.

Flights from East London, South Africa - King Phalo Airport (ELS)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,207 miles (13,208 kilometres). The direct flight time is roughly 18 hours 44 minutes.

Flights from Hoedspruit, South Africa - AFB Airport (HDS)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,096 miles (13,029 kilometres). The direct flight time is roughly 18 hours 29 minutes.

Flights from Kimberley, South Africa - Kimberley Airport (KIM)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,909 miles (12,729 kilometres). The direct flight time is roughly 18 hours 4 minutes.

Flights from Nelspruit, South Africa - Kruger Mpumalanga Intl Airport (MQP)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,134 miles (13,090 kilometres). The direct flight time is roughly 18 hours 34 minutes.

Flights from Phalaborwa, South Africa - Hendrik van Eck Airport (PHW)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,087 miles (13,015 kilometres). The direct flight time is roughly 18 hours 28 minutes.

Flights from Pietermaritzburg, South Africa - Pietermaritzburg Airport (PZB)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,236 miles (13,255 kilometres). The direct flight time is roughly 18 hours 48 minutes.

Flights from Polokwane, South Africa - Polokwane International Airport (PTG)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,991 miles (12,861 kilometres). The direct flight time is roughly 18 hours 15 minutes.

Flights from Richards Bay, South Africa - Richards Bay Airport (RCB)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,298 miles (13,354 kilometres). The direct flight time is roughly 18 hours 56 minutes.

Flights from Upington, South Africa - Upington Airport (UTN) to Duck, North Carolina (DUF) - The flight distance between these airports is 7,711 miles (12,410 kilometres). The direct flight time is roughly 17 hours 38 minutes.

Flights from Umtata, South Africa - K.D. Matanzima Airport (UTT) to Duck, North Carolina (DUF) - The flight distance between these airports is 8,205 miles (13,204 kilometres). The direct flight time is roughly 18 hours 43 minutes.

Travel Videos About Duck, North Carolina

Choose Site / Currency

ZAR/South Africa